The Lapidárium Gallery in Prague 1 is an unobtrusive but all the more interesting exhibition space where old and new art meet in one place. There is currently an exhibition of the famous Italian author Giancarlo Moscara.
“Giancarlo Moscara was an outstanding designer and painter who, although he died in 2019, left a significant artistic mark, mainly in the field of experimental painting. In the Lapidárium Gallery, we now have the opportunity to see his unique works and thus have a unique opportunity to look into his work,” explains exhibition curator Marisa Milella.
In addition to the fact that the exhibition presents this important artist from the Italian city of Lecce, the organizers wanted to draw attention to the connection between Italian artists and the Czech capital.
“The Italians influenced many things in Prague, many things with their taste, buildings, architecture. When you walk through Old Prague, you can see many Italian elements and many Italian inspirations,” said Světlana Kalousková – manager of Galerie Lapidárium.
Giancarlo Moscara was known for the fact that, although he himself was very educated, he did not allow himself to be bound by any schools and styles, therefore his work is based on maximum creative freedom.
“Giancarlo Moscara is essentially such a symbol of creative freedom and color. He has a wonderful, truly Italian elegant color,” said Světlana Kalousková – manager of the Lapidárium Gallery.
